[0001] This disclosure relates to a method of manufacturing a hair trimmer attachment, and particularly, but not exclusively, to a method of forming a fixed blade component of the hair trimmer attachment. Background Technology
[0002] See Figure 1 Electric hair trimmers typically include a detachable trimmer attachment 2, which includes a fixed blade 10 and a movable blade (not shown). The fixed blade 10 typically takes the form of a shield defining a skin contact surface 12 that is held against the user's skin during use of the hair trimmer. The fixed blade 10 defines a plurality of guard teeth 14 and hair openings 16 formed between the guard teeth. Hair can enter the hair openings 16 to be cut between the cutting elements of the fixed and movable blades.
[0003] See Figure 2a and Figure 2b In the use of the hair trimmer, trimmer attachment 2 can be used in the hair cutting direction D. H The trimmer attachment 2 moves across the user's skin. As shown, when the trimmer attachment 2 moves across the user's skin, hairs 4 in contact with the distal surface 14a of the protective teeth may deflect downwards toward the skin without entering the hair opening 16 or being cut by the hair trimmer.

[0039] See Figure 3 and Figure 4 The hair trimmer accessory 100 for a hair trimmer includes a fixed blade 110, a fixed blade support 120, a movable blade 130, a movable blade support 140, and a transmission component 150.
[0040] like Figure 3 and Figure 4 As shown, the fixed blade 110 can form a protective barrier for the hair trimmer attachment 100, limiting contact between the user's skin and the movable blade 130 of the hair trimmer attachment 100. The fixed blade 110 may include a sheet formed above and supported by the fixed blade support 120. The fixed blade 110 includes a skin contact portion 112 that defines a skin contact surface 112a, which is held against the user's skin during use of the hair trimmer. The skin contact surface 112a may be planar, for example, defining a flat or curved plane.
[0041] The fixed blade 110 also includes an angled portion 114, which is angled relative to the skin contact portion 112. For example, the angled portion 114 may be angled relative to the skin contact portion 112 at an angle between 90 degrees and 180 degrees. When the skin contact surface 112a is placed against the user's skin, the angled portion 114 may extend away from the user's skin. As shown, the angled portion 114 extends from the lateral side of the skin contact portion. The fixed blade 110 may be coupled to the fixed blade support 120 at the angled portion.
[0042] A bend 116 is formed between the skin contact portion 112 and the angled portion 114. In the illustrated arrangement, the bend 116 is a smooth, continuous bend formed about an axis extending in a first direction D1 of the hair trimmer attachment 100. In other arrangements, the bend 116 may include one or more discontinuous changes in the angle between the skin contact portion 112 and the angled portion 114.
[0043] Multiple hair openings 118 are formed in the fixed blade 110. As shown, the multiple hair openings 118 can be located in the longitudinal direction D of the hair trimmer attachment 100. L The upper curved portion 116 is spaced apart. The hair opening 118 can extend from the curved portion 116 into the skin contact portion 112 and / or the angled portion 114 of the fixed blade 110 to form a hair opening 118 of a desired size for receiving hair.
[0044] A portion of the fixed blade 110 between the hair openings 118 (e.g., a portion of the skin contact area 112, a portion of the curved portion 116, and a portion of the angular portion 114) can form a protective tooth 119 for the fixed blade 110. The curved portion 116, and optionally the portion of the skin contact area and / or the angular portion adjacent to the curved portion 116, can form the distal end 119a of the protective tooth 119 when the hair trimmer attachment 100 is along the hair cutting direction D. H As it moves across the user's skin, the distal end 119a first contacts the hair. For example... Figure 4 As shown, the fixed blade 110 may include a plurality of protective teeth 119 forming a protective comb.
[0045] like Figure 3 and Figure 4 As shown, the hair trimmer attachment 100 can be symmetrical in the lateral direction of the hair trimmer attachment, and can include an angled portion 114, a curved portion 116, and a plurality of hair openings 118 on each lateral side of the skin contact portion 112. As shown, the angled portions 114 provided on any lateral side can be arranged at the same angle relative to the skin contact portion, or they can be at different angles.
[0046] The movable blade 130 is held against the fixed blade 110 by a movable blade support 140 and, in use of the hair trimmer, is moved relative to the fixed blade 110 by a transmission member 150, for example, reciprocating. The movable blade 130 may include blade element combs on each lateral side of the movable blade 130, the blade element combs corresponding to the hair openings 118 combs in the fixed blade. The blade elements may be configured to engage with the edges of guard teeth 119 to cut hair entering the hair openings 118. In some arrangements, the pitch and / or pattern of the blade element combs on the movable blade 130 may differ from the pitch and / or pattern of the hair openings 118 in the fixed blade, for example, to cause the corresponding guard teeth 119 to interlace with the hair between the blade elements.
[0047] You can choose hair opening 118 in the longitudinal direction D. LThe width of the upper part is adjusted to balance the hair-cutting performance of the hair trimmer, user comfort, and the structural strength of the fixed blade 110. Providing a wider hair opening 118 separated by narrower guard teeth allows the hair trimmer attachment 100 to be positioned within the hair-cutting direction D of the hair trimmer. H During the upward movement, more hair is received into the hair opening 118. Furthermore, narrower guard teeth can contact and deflect fewer hairs, resulting in fewer hairs being deflected and uncut. However, increasing the width of the hair opening 118 can reduce user comfort because the user's skin can more easily, at least partially, enter the hair opening 118. Reducing the width of the guard teeth 119 can increase pressure on the user's skin during use of the hair trimmer and can reduce the structural strength of the retaining blade 110, for example, at the distal end 119a of the guard teeth, potentially shortening the lifespan of the hair trimmer accessory 100 before it must be replaced.
[0048] In one or more arrangements, the width of the hair opening 118 (e.g., in the longitudinal direction D) L The width of the hair opening 118 can be 0.3 mm, for example, approximately 0.3 mm. For example, the width of the hair opening 118 can be between 0.25 mm and 0.4 mm. The width of the protective tooth 119 (e.g., in the longitudinal direction D...) L The width of the tooth (on the tooth) can be 0.3 mm, for example, about 0.3 mm. For example, the width of the guard tooth 119 can be 0.3 mm or greater.
[0049] See Figure 5 Hair trimmer attachments, such as hair trimmer attachment 100, can be manufactured according to method 500. Method 500 includes a first frame 502, providing material for forming the retaining blade 110. The material can be a sheet, such as a foil, or a metal foil. Alternatively, the material can be a polymeric material or a composite material, such as a metal with a polymer coating. The thickness of the material can be 0.1 mm, for example, about 0.1 mm, such as between 0.08 mm and 0.15 mm.
[0050] The material provided at the first frame 502 may include the net shape of the retaining blade 110 for the hair trimmer attachment 100. The material may include openings configured to, for example, form hair openings 118 in the retaining blade 110 once the material is formed. The sheet and the openings for forming the hair openings 118 can be manufactured using any desired process or processes. For example, the material can be manufactured using stamping or etching processes. Alternatively, an electroforming process, such as nickel electroforming, can be used to grow the material into the desired shape.
[0051] Method 500 also includes a second frame 504 that deforms the sheet on the fixed blade support 120 of the hair trimmer attachment, thereby creating a bend 116 between the skin contact portion 112 and the angled portion 114 of the fixed blade. As described above, the bend 116 may be bent and / or angled about an axis extending in the first direction, and at the second frame, the fixed blade 110 may be deformed about an axis extending in the first direction D1, for example, bent, folded, or angled.
[0052] As mentioned above Figure 3 and Figure 4 The hair trimmer attachment 100 may be symmetrical and may include an angled portion 114 located on either lateral side of the fixed blade 110. The second block 504 of method 500 may be repeated to create a bend 116 on the other lateral side of the fixed blade 110, between the skin contact portion 112 and the angled portion 114.
[0053] Method 500 also includes a third frame 506, where a compound bend and / or angular portion is formed on the guard tooth 119 (e.g., at the distal end 119a of the guard tooth). In other words, at the third frame 506, the surface of the fixed blade 110 forming the distal end 119a of the guard tooth 119, for example, the portion of the guard tooth 119 that can first contact the hair when the hair trimmer moves along the hair trimming direction, can be formed or shaped as an axis extending about a first direction D1 and in a second direction perpendicular to the first direction D1 (e.g., ...). Figure 6a and Figure 7a The axis extending on (as shown) is bent and / or angled. In some arrangements, the surface of the fixed blade 110 forming the distal end 119a of the guard tooth can be formed or shaped such that the surface is spherical, for example, forming a portion of a spherical surface.
[0054] The composite bend and / or angled portion can be formed on the guard teeth without removing material from the fixed blade. More specifically, the composite bend and / or angled portion can be formed on the guard teeth without removing material from the fixed blade, thereby reducing the material width of the guard teeth relative to at least the thickness of the sheet forming the guard teeth. Therefore, the length of one guard tooth 119 surrounding the composite bend and / or angled portion in a plane parallel to the skin contact portion and / or the first direction can be substantially equal to or greater than the width of one guard tooth in the guard teeth before the composite bend portion is formed (e.g., before the third frame 506 of method 500). For example, the length surrounding the composite bend and / or angled portion can be 0.3 mm or more, or 0.25 mm or more.
[0055] For example, compared to hair trimmer attachments that remove material from the fixed blade to shape the protective tooth, forming a composite bend and / or angular portion on the protective tooth in this manner can improve the structural strength of the fixed blade 110 at the distal end 119a of the protective tooth.
[0056] In some arrangements, the composite bending and / or angular portions of the fixed blade may be formed from a sheet material, for example, provided at the first frame 502, for example exclusively formed from that sheet material.
[0057] Figure 6a A partial cross-section of the guard tooth 119 and the fixed blade support 120 passing through the fixed blade 110 in a plane parallel to the skin contact portion 112 and the first direction D1 is depicted after the completion of the second frame 504 and before the completion of the third frame 506 in method 500. As shown, at this stage of method 500, the cross-section of the distal end 119a of the guard tooth 119 is substantially flat and planar.
[0058] like Figure 6a and Figure 6b As shown, the portion of the fixed blade support 120 on which each protective tooth of the fixed blade 110 is deformed can have a bent and / or angled shape about an axis extending about a second direction D2 perpendicular to the first direction D1. At the third block 506 of the method, a compound bent and / or angled portion is formed on the distal end 119a of the protective tooth by deforming each portion of the fixed blade 110 forming the protective tooth in a compound bent and / or angled shape on the corresponding axis extending about the second direction D2 of the fixed blade support 120. Specifically, the bent and / or angled portion can be formed by bending and / or angled the fixed blade 110, such as the distal end 119a of the protective tooth, about an axis extending about the second direction D2. Figure 6b As shown, the protective teeth can be deformed to conform to the compound bending and / or angular shape of the fixed blade support 120.
[0059] Figure 7a A partial cross-sectional view is shown of the guard teeth 719 of the fixed blade 710 and the fixed blade support 720 of a hair trimmer attachment 700 arranged in another manner according to this disclosure. The hair trimmer attachment 700 is similar to the hair trimmer attachment 100, and the features described above that are associated with the hair trimmer attachment 100 are equally applicable to the hair trimmer attachment 700.
[0060] Figure 7a The partial cross-section shown is located in a plane parallel to the skin contact portion of the fixed blade 710 and the first direction D1. Figure 7aThe diagram shows the fixed blade 710 and fixed blade support 720 after the second frame 504 is completed and before the third frame 506 is completed. As shown, at this stage of method 500, the cross-section of the distal end 719a of the guard tooth is substantially flat and planar.
[0061] like Figure 7b As shown, at the third frame 506, a bent and / or angled portion can be formed on the protective tooth 719 by applying a layer of material 770 to the protective tooth. This layer may include a polymer material, which can be applied to the protective tooth and cured to form the material 770 layer.
[0062] exist Figure 7a and Figure 7b In the arrangement shown, the portion of the fixed blade support 720 supporting one of the protective teeth 119 does not include a compound bend or angled shape. However, in other arrangements, the shape of the fixed blade support 720 may be similar to... Figure 6a and Figure 6b The fixed blade support 120 depicted in the image has the same shape.
[0063] Reference Figure 8 In some arrangements, after forming the complex bends and / or angular portions on the guard teeth, the edges of the guard teeth 119 are smoothed, for example, by removing burrs 800 present on the edges of the guard teeth, such as those defining hair openings 118. The thickness of the material removed from the retaining blade 110, for example, the depth or radius of the cavity applied to the edge of the retaining blade to smooth the edge of the guard teeth, can be less than the thickness of the sheet forming the retaining blade. Therefore, in a plane parallel to the skin contact portion and / or the first direction, the length of the complex bends and / or angular portions surrounding at least the thickness of the sheet after smoothing can remain unchanged.
[0064] See Figure 9a and Figure 9b By forming composite bends and / or angled portions on the protective teeth 119, 719, the protective teeth can be shaped such that, during use of the hair trimmer, when the fixed blades 110, 710 are in the hair trimming direction D... H During upward movement, due to the curved and / or angular shape of the distal ends 119a and 719a of the guard teeth, hairs that are not aligned with the hair opening 118 and are in contact with the guard teeth are laterally pushed towards the hair opening 118. Hairs pushed towards the hair openings 118 and 718 can enter the hair openings to reach the movable blades, thereby being trimmed by the hair trimmer along with hairs already aligned with the hair openings. Therefore, forming curved and / or angular portions on the guard teeth can increase the trimmer's performance in the hair trimming direction D. HThe amount of hair trimmed by the hair trimmer during a single movement. As mentioned above, the width of the guard teeth and the opening can be selected to balance hair-cutting performance with skin comfort and the structural strength of the retaining blade. However, by forming curved and / or angled portions on the guard teeth as described herein, the hair-cutting performance of the hair trimmer can be improved without affecting skin comfort or the structural strength of the retaining blade.
